So, for example, to get the voltage at the drain of the MOSFET (swinging end of primary
winding), we need to add V
IN
(voltage at other end of winding), to the voltage waveform
that represents the voltage across the primary winding. That is how we got the voltage
waveforms shown in Figure 10.1 .
